Analysis

Syrian Arab Republic recorded 121.52 % change on previous year for final consumption expenditure (current us$), annual growth rate in 2022. That is the highest value across all 62 years on record.

The figure is up 36,477.0% on the previous year and up 603.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, final consumption expenditure (current us$), annual growth rate in Syrian Arab Republic peaked at 121.52 % change on previous year in 2022 and was at its lowest, -49.06 % change on previous year, in 2020.

Syrian Arab Republic ranks 1st of 187 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Final consumption expenditure (current US$).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.

Computed from

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
